Malkangiri: Important documents and records were reduced to ashes in a major fire at collector’s office in Malkangiri on Thursday.
The incident took place around 3 pm and all employees were evacuated unharmed. It took two fire tenders more than two hours to douse the flames.
“The actual financial loss is being ascertained. The gutted documents include land records relating to forest right committees,” an official informed.
An electrical short circuit suspected to have caused the fire, the official added.
